Dov Hertz Spending $250M On Massive Sunset Park Development Site

DH Property Holdings, led by developer Dov Hertz, is reportedly in contract to pay $250M for an 18-acre development site on the Gowanus Canal.

Sunset Industrial Park, at 50 21st St., could feature as much as 1.6M SF of warehouse development, Crain’s New York Business reports.

The seller, 601 W Cos., was first seeking as much as $300M, according to Crain's. Hertz is partnering with investment firm Bridge Development Partners on the deal, which is set to close later this year.

Hertz is also planning a 350K SF, three-story distribution center on a 4-acre site in Red Hook. The company bought that site, at 640 Columbia St., with Goldman Sachs Asset Management for $47.5M in February.

The plan is to build a new warehouse and distribution hub on this site in Sunset Park, too, according to The Real Deal.

Hertz is one of the developers in the city who is banking that multistory warehouse space will be in high demand in the city, as the need for urban distribution centers goes up.

“I think people are still waiting to see if the [multistory] thesis bears out ... [But] we feel there’s a demand, and there’s very little in the way of supply.” Hertz told Bisnow earlier this year.

However, he said at Bisnow's industrial event in February that finding space to build those types of distribution centers on is a challenge.
